That's a weird error, since HFS it's not using "UTF8VCL" (although it seems to be related to "Kryvich's Delphi Localizer", but you are the first person to report a problem). Are you using some translated version of HFS? (like this version).

Please do this: try running HFS v2.3k Build #299 Spanish Beta and see if it gives you the same error or if it starts normally, but run it on a separate (different) folder (this is very important), without copying any personal file there (if you have another HFS version running, please close it before running this other version). Just unzip it to some folder, and run hfs.exe without adding or deleting any other file (and do not update it to the last version, just for doing this test). If the error continues, try closing any other software you have open (like for example: keynote-nf or any other software). Then please report the results here. ;)

I went and followed your steps. I downloaded the version you linked, put it in a separate empty folder and ran it. It still gives me the same error. After getting the error again, I closed off some programs and tried again. Still the same error.

Just for testing sake, I looked around on the internet for an older build. To which I stumbled upon a download of 2.3j (#298). And funny enough, it totally works. No problems at all. Does not even matter what it is in.
